Loaded Cobb Potato Skins

Loaded Cobb Potato Skins are a delicious mash up of Cobb salad and potato skins. These game day appetizers will challenge your tastebuds. A total game changer!
Print Pin
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 1 hour
Total Time: 1 hour 15 minutes
Servings: 6
Calories: 249kcal
Author: Cathy Trochelman

Ingredients

  • 3 medium potatoes
  • 1/2 cup sour cream
  • 2 teaspoons ranch dressing mix
  • 1/2 cup corn cooked in a skillet until charred
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 6 pieces bacon cooked & chopped
  • 1/4 cup blue cheese crumbles
  • 1 small tomato chopped
  • 2 Tablespoons fresh parsley chopped

Instructions

  • Wash potatoes and prick with a fork. Bake at 425 degrees for 45 minutes. Let cool. (Lower oven temp to 400.)
  • Cut potatoes in half lengthwise and scoop out the center of each.
  • Combine sour cream and ranch dressing mix in a small bowl. Divide evenly among potato skins.
  • Top with corn, shredded cheese, bacon, and blue cheese, divided evenly among potato skins.
  • Bake at 400 degrees 10-15 minutes or until cheese is completely melted.
  • Top each potato skin with chopped tomatoes and parsley.
